Eva Matzko
January 6, 2021
Eva Matzko, formerly a long-time resident of Monroeville, peacefully passed away on January 6th in Rhode Island surrounded by family and loved ones. Born May,16, 1926 she is the widow of George R. Matzko and is survived by her five children, seven grandchildren, two great grandchildren and all their loved ones. Her oldest son, Mike and Judy Brumfield, Joseph and his wife Rene, Mary and Paul Darak, Suzanne Ferreira, and her youngest son, George; her grandchildren Michael, Rhiannon, Ryan, Kevin, Morgan, Joseph, and Jay; her great-grandchildren, Shayla and Michael; her youngest brother, George and his wife Linda, and many nieces and nephews. She is preceded in death by her sisters, Dorothy Novak and Olga Drahusz and her brother Emil Drahusz (surviving wife, Shirley). She had great happiness seeing and sharing time with her children and (great) grandchildren spread out across the country. She was very involved with the Byzantine Catholic “Church of the Resurrection” while she lived in Monroeville and enjoyed her last years with Mary, Paul and Suzanne who live in Rhode Island. She always had a song to sing and smile to share. Her service will be private, and she will be placed alongside her husband at St. Joseph’s Cemetery in North Versailles.
